While Modest Mouse actually formed back in the early '90s, it was the band's 2004 platinum album, Good News for People Who Love Bad News, that launched them to the next level of rock stardom, earning them a Grammy Award nomination for Best Alternative Music Album in 2005 and another nomination in the Best Rock Song category for the single âFloat On."
Now, over two decades later, the beloved alt-rockers are still doing what they do best...and much to the delight of their many devoted fans, they just announced a string of 2026 tour dates via Instagram.
Following Modest Mouse's previously announced Ice Cream Floats Cruise from Feb. 5 to 9, the band will launch a spring tour kicking off on May 12 in Spokane, Washington, playing several more dates in the west (scheduled around Salt Lake Cityâs Kilby Block Party in May) before heading east. After another series of shows in locations such as New Haven and Virginia Beach, they'll wrap things up with an appearance at Tennessee's Bonnaroo festival on June 14.

An artist presale is already underway for Ice Cream Party members, with tickets going on sale for the general public on Friday, Jan. 30 at 10 a.m. local time. Washington, D.C. area fans will also have the chance to see Modest Mouse open for My Chemical Romance on August 18 at Nationals Park.
Isaac Brock once opened up about being a 'three-time-Grammy nominee loser'
In a 2024 interview with Spin, Modest Mouse frontman Isaac Brock opened up about how he felt when "Float On" lost the Grammy to U2's "Vertigo."
âEveryone says they donât care and at the moment, it feels like they donât care, but it was like, âYes, how nice it is to be a contender in a sport you didnât know you were playing,ââ he said. "Itâs like a game you didnât think you were trying to win. I didnât even know it was a game. I thought it was music, but I guess thereâs awards."
âAs someone whoâs been a three-time-Grammy nominee loser, I can tell you it would now feel really nice to not find out," Brock quipped, adding, "Itâs like if thereâs a sweepstakes and they didnât ever enter you in it and they just sent you notices saying you didnât win. The third time you got the notice, youâd be like, âFâk, they sent me another letter. I hope I didnât lose again.ââ
